Arrest of 'El Jardinero' Cartel Leader in Mexico

In a move that underscores the Mexican government's commitment to combating organized crime, the armed forces successfully apprehended Odysseus Flores Silva, known as 'El Jardinero', who is considered one of the leading figures of the Jalisco New Generation Cartel. The operation took place in a northern tourist city, where Flores was hiding under the protection of a group of armed men.

This operation comes on the heels of the death of the cartel's previous leader, Nemesio Oseguera Cervantes, known as 'El Mencho', in February. U.S. authorities had identified Flores as a potential successor to 'El Mencho', making his capture even more critical.

Operation Details

According to a statement from the Mexican Navy, the operation was executed with extreme precision and without firing a single shot, utilizing aerial and ground surveillance techniques to locate Flores. He was captured after a 19-month pursuit during which his movements were tracked, and his hiding place was identified.

The location where Flores was found was surrounded by approximately 60 armed men and 30 trucks. However, the forces managed to apprehend him after discovering him hiding in a ditch by the roadside.

Background & Context

The Jalisco New Generation Cartel is considered one of the most dangerous cartels in Mexico and was classified as a terrorist organization by the United States in 2025. Following the death of 'El Mencho', the country has witnessed a noticeable increase in violence related to organized crime, including attacks on businesses and vehicle burnings.

The cartel's operations have been marked by extreme brutality, and its influence has spread across various regions, posing significant challenges to law enforcement and public safety in Mexico.

Impact & Consequences

The arrest of Flores is expected to have a substantial impact on the operations of the Jalisco New Generation Cartel. Drug trafficking experts have described him as a prominent figure, and it is believed that his arrest could affect the cartel's operations more significantly than the death of 'El Mencho'.

Mexican authorities are striving to regain control over areas dominated by cartels, yet challenges remain, including ongoing violence and the potential for retaliatory actions from cartel members.
